BALDWIN, Ga. — Fire staffing and spending took center stage Tuesday as Baldwin city leaders revisited previously delayed agenda items, ultimately approving two public safety measures while deferring a decision on adding personnel. The Baldwin City Council approved both the Habersham County Local Emergency Operating Plan and an automatic aid agreement with the Cornelia Fire Department without objection.
